1,300-Pound NASA Satellite Falling to Earth After 14-Year Mission

1,300-Pound NASA Satellite Falling to Earth After 14-Year Mission

NASA's Van Allen Probe A, a 1,300-pound satellite that spent 14 years studying Earth's radiation belts, is making an uncontrolled re-entry into Earth's atmosphere tonight. The mission, originally designed for two years, contributed to over 700 scientific publications before solar activity accelerated its descent.
